1.gzip和bzip2
\qquad
gzip和bzip2的處理解壓和壓縮的功能並不強大,一是:不能處理打包壓縮;二是:gzip壓縮不保留原檔案,bzip2 -k 要壓縮的檔案
可以保留原檔案;三是:只能壓縮檔案,不能壓縮目錄。
\qquad
gzip處理.gz格式的壓縮包;bzip2處理.bz2格式的壓縮包。
2. tar
\qquad
tar是最常用的壓縮命令之一。
2.1 tar引數
c——建立壓縮包
x——解壓壓縮包
v——顯示壓縮或解壓過程中的提示資訊
f——指定壓縮檔案的名字
z——使用gzip方式壓縮檔案,壓縮後的檔案為.gz格式,解壓.gz格式
j——使用bzip2方式壓縮檔案,壓縮後的檔案為.bz2格式,或者解壓.bz2格式檔案
#當tar命令不使用z或j引數時,只能打包,不能壓縮
2.2 tar壓縮tar zcvf 生成的壓縮包名字(***.tar.gz) 要壓縮的檔案或者目錄 #使用gzip方式壓縮檔案
tar jcvf 生成的壓縮包名字(***.tar.bz2) 要壓縮的檔案或者目錄 #使用bzip2方式壓縮檔案
2.3 tar解壓tar zxvf 要解壓的壓縮包名字(.gz格式)
#解壓到當前目錄下
tar zxvf 要解壓的壓縮包名字 (.gz格式) -c 解壓到的目錄的路徑 #解壓到指定的目錄
tar jxvf 要解壓的壓縮包名字(.bz2格式)
#解壓到當前目錄下
tar jxvf 要解壓的壓縮包名字 (.bz2格式) -c 解壓到的目錄的路徑 #解壓到指定的目錄
3.rar
3.1 rar的安裝
sudo
apt-get
install
rar#在ubuntu作業系統中
sudo yum install
rar#在centos作業系統中
3.2 rar的引數a——壓縮
x——解壓
3.3壓縮和解壓rar a 生成的壓縮包的名字(不用新增字尾,rar自動新增字尾.rar) 要壓縮的檔案或者目錄
rar x 要解壓的壓縮的檔案 要解壓到的目錄(沒有解壓目錄時,預設解壓到當前目錄下)
4.zip
4.1 zip的壓縮
zip 壓縮包的名字 要壓縮的檔案或者目錄
4.2 zip的解壓unzip 要解壓的壓縮包的名字 #解壓到當前目錄下
unzip 要解壓的壓縮包的名字 -d 解壓到指定的目錄路徑
Linux 常用的壓縮和解壓操作
壓縮檔案 tar czvf test.tar.gz test 解壓檔案 tar xzvf test.tar.gz常用引數 c 壓縮檔案 create x 解開壓縮檔案 t 檢視 tar 裡的檔案 z 是否需要用 gzip 壓縮 j 是否需要用 bzip2 壓縮 v 壓縮的過程中顯示檔案 f 使用檔名...
Linux常用壓縮和解壓命令
tar 解包 tar xvf filename.tar tar 打包 tar cvf filename.tar dirname gz 解壓1 gunzip filename.gz gz 解壓2 gzip d filename.gz gz 壓縮 gzip filename tar.gz 和 tgz 解...
Linux常用壓縮和解壓命令
tar 解包 tar xvf filename.tar tar 打包 tar cvf filename.tar dirname gz 解壓1 gunzip filename.gz gz 解壓2 gzip d filename.gz gz 壓縮 gzip filename tar.gz 和 tgz 解...